The PM8150B has a dedicated USB type C block, which can be used for type C orientation and role detection. Create the reference node to this type C block for further use.
Signed-off-by: Wesley Cheng <wcheng@codeaurora.org> --- arch/arm64/boot/dts/qcom/pm8150b.dtsi | 7 +++++++ 1 file changed, 7 insertions(+)
diff --git a/arch/arm64/boot/dts/qcom/pm8150b.dtsi b/arch/arm64/boot/dts/qcom/pm8150b.dtsi index e112e8876db6..053c659734a7 100644 --- a/arch/arm64/boot/dts/qcom/pm8150b.dtsi +++ b/arch/arm64/boot/dts/qcom/pm8150b.dtsi @@ -53,6 +53,13 @@ power-on@800 { status = "disabled"; }; + pm8150b_typec: typec@1500 { + compatible = "qcom,pm8150b-usb-typec"; + status = "disabled"; + reg = <0x1500>; + interrupts = <0x2 0x15 0x5 IRQ_TYPE_EDGE_RISING>; + }; + pm8150b_temp: temp-alarm@2400 { compatible = "qcom,spmi-temp-alarm"; reg = <0x2400>; -- The Qualcomm Innovation Center, Inc. is a member of the Code Aurora Forum, a Linux Foundation Collaborative Project
